Beautiful picture. The beast is still gathering itself after t/o. Prop sync not engaged, landing gears in transition. I always wondered about the unique and most unusual nlg door arrangement of the herc. Conventionally, the doors are split sideways and swing about the longitudnal axis. Here the large door panel pivots on the lateral axis exposed fully to the airflow. Requiring greater hydraulic forces to operate and strong door panels.
Wonder what the 50s designers from Lockheed had in mind or were compelled due to space constraints.
I read somewhere, C130 is the 'most beautiful ugly aircraft'

Abbass we can also say 'charlie has looks only mother would like'. jokes apart, c-130 is by far the most successful aircraft ever. Sometime referred to as an aviation fluke. I read somewhere that first production aircraft is till in active service. With current US DoD plans, the C-130s are planned to remain in service and production till later half of 21st century, which if achieved will make it only aircraft to remain in active service for more than 100 years.
